Many employees travel for their job. What happens when you pay benefits in the claimant’s home State, but the third-party action is in the defendant’s home State? What statute applies? How can you ensure you are still getting your maximum recovery? In this episode, "Out-of-State Accidents: Choice of Law, Federal Cases, and Harmonizing Subrogation Statutes (https://loisllc.com/webinar/out-of-state-accidents-choice-of-law-federal-cases-and-harmonizing-subrogation-statutes/)," Christopher Major (https://loisllc.com/attorney/christopher-major/), Civil Practice Team Leader at Lois Law Firm, discusses how to navigate multijurisdictional claims, how to monitor or intervene in a federal case, and how to blend statutes to ensure you receive your maximum reimbursement.

Major discusses the following:

The choice of law doctrine in New York and New Jersey. When to expect a federal action and how to find it on PACER. The availability of remedies such as loss transfer for out-of-State accidents or foreign workers’ compensation claims. How to use basic rights of contract to “pick and choose” the most favorable reimbursement scheme.
